Im not a 'diehard' fan of the comic, or any comic for that matter, but I know the basics.

I saw the movie last night and it was well worth the price of admission. I am not well versed enough in the comics storylines to pick apart every minor 'flaw' in the film, so I wont do that. I just know that I went in expecting a good film about Spiderman and I left satisfied.

Anyway...

My favorite charechter from the comic is Venom and I know if they do many sequals they will have to incorporate him into the story. I was ver pleased that Eddie Brock was 'kinda sorta' mentioned.

It seems that, if it actually happens, the next films villian will be Harry- in a 'bitter son attempts revenge on the man who killed his father' story- and it would be stupid of them to end the film they way they did without using Harry in that role the next time around.

My question: When will they use Venom, and how may they go about putting him into the film (I doubt theyd do the symbiote/ space suit storyline exactly the way it is in the comics, but they cant just say 'Hey, Eddie Brock is pissed off and look at what he can do !'?

The Brock/ Venom story, in my opinion, is one of the best storys to be told but it will be hard for the filmakers to put it in the film without pissing off comic fans or going over the heads of the general public.

I personally hope they stay the hell away from the whole Venom thing. There are soooooo many good villians they could use instead who would not require 2 hours of backstory. Doc Ock Vulture Scorpion Lizard The Beetle (not Ringo) Sandman Kingpin (yeah I know he's gonna be in Daredevil but he was Parker's foe too) Mysterio Electro Kraven the Hunter The Chameleon Shocker Rhino Smythe The Spot (my fave loser, he would be a good henchman)

Villians to steer clear of Venom (6 years of backstory needed) Carnage (see above) Hobgoblin (too similar to Green Goblin)

Why does everyone always think Harry Osborne becomes the Hobgoblin? He doesn't! Harry becomes the second Green Goblin. The Hobgoblin is an entirely different person.

If you ask me, I figure Harry will be using the Osborne money to finance the distruction of Spider-Man. Hiring villians and the like.
